Commit Graph

42 Commits

Author SHA1 Message Date
Jeroen Engels
dddba5c1cf Stop using Rule.withMetadata in plugin rules 2022-04-28 13:25:24 +02:00
Jeroen Engels
8ab6272a39 Backport rules from other packages 2022-04-22 22:04:13 +02:00
Jeroen Engels
b71984aebb Backport rules from elm-review-unused 2021-10-24 00:38:58 +02:00
Jeroen Engels
7e6cd42469 Backport rules 2021-08-19 20:57:33 +02:00
Jeroen Engels
dda4c684b1 Simplify code 2021-04-24 14:33:20 +02:00
Jeroen Engels
05d2622923 Backport rules from elm-review-unused 2021-04-17 21:18:43 +02:00
Jeroen Engels
9992afbff8 Backport rules from elm-review-unused 2021-04-06 17:19:13 +02:00
Jeroen Engels
cee660cd0a Stop using tests/Dependencies/ElmCore.elm and remove it 2021-03-14 09:12:41 +01:00
Jeroen Engels
a4bb1719b5 Backport rules from elm-review-code-style 2021-02-10 17:15:09 +01:00
Jeroen Engels
584f0bef8a Adapt tests to elm-syntax fix 2021-02-02 16:03:05 +01:00
Jeroen Engels
4669fe3960 Backport elm-review-unused 2021-01-24 16:46:42 +01:00
Jeroen Engels
cb604c782f Backport unused and test-values 2020-12-23 19:12:04 +01:00
Jeroen Engels
c6ca7ec9fe Backport elm-review-unused 2020-12-05 12:40:40 +01:00
Jeroen Engels
b1b96c6dcf Backport rules from other projects 2020-09-23 08:11:51 +02:00
Jeroen Engels
3087e757a8 Fix module name lookup table not knowing about patterns inside let functions destructuring 2020-09-08 10:06:28 +02:00
Jeroen Engels
31eef5486b Use lookup table in NoUnused.CustomTypeConstructors 2020-08-22 09:43:30 +02:00
Jeroen Engels
808baa1a22 Use lookup table in NoUnused.Exports 2020-08-22 08:50:39 +02:00
Jeroen Engels
449b21addd Backport rules from other packages 2020-08-09 18:56:12 +02:00
Jeroen Engels
aa72525032 Remove unused function 2020-06-28 13:44:52 +02:00
Jeroen Engels
4c43013fb8 Remove Rule3 2020-06-28 08:01:44 +02:00
Jeroen Engels
d2220e652b Use Rule instead of Rule3 2020-06-28 08:01:44 +02:00
Jeroen Engels
c8445f7bf6 Rename all _New functions 2020-06-25 22:57:31 +02:00
Jeroen Engels
8216097025 Rename ModuleVisitor into ModuleRuleSchema, until the next breaking change 2020-06-25 22:52:11 +02:00
Jeroen Engels
94b0ab6a79 Turn module visitors into project rules 2020-06-25 22:49:44 +02:00
Jeroen Engels
b66816b589 Add module visitors to project rules 2020-06-25 19:23:09 +02:00
Jeroen Engels
dc131e8265 Use new module rules in tests 2020-06-25 19:23:09 +02:00
Jeroen Engels
c9e8f9680d Backport changes from review dependencies 2020-06-20 20:09:03 +02:00
Jeroen Engels
748583e778 Deprecate Direction 2020-06-19 15:35:11 +02:00
Jeroen Engels
cfd7a9157e Rename enter and exit visitors 2020-06-16 22:03:18 +02:00
Jeroen Engels
767a7ba321 Use onEnter variants on test rules 2020-06-16 00:00:41 +02:00
Jeroen Engels
acc00dfc3f Backport changes from review-unused and elm-review-scope 2020-06-14 16:44:44 +02:00
Jeroen Engels
932c788b9f Backport work from review packages 2020-06-03 18:23:19 +02:00
Jeroen Engels
c76d4d972f Make expected errors order-agnostic
Fixes #12
2020-05-17 17:08:27 +02:00
Jeroen Engels
ee8f294c18 Backport scope v0.2.0 2020-05-16 22:44:11 +02:00
Jeroen Engels
f1e3e725a8 Backport work from review-unused 2020-05-14 21:24:29 +02:00
Jeroen Engels
d0bd0579f3 Fix Review.Test not working correctly with multilines 2020-05-14 21:24:29 +02:00
Jeroen Engels
33c85462ed Backport work from review packages and elm-review-scope 2020-04-21 23:01:47 +02:00
Jeroen Engels
418a50e183 Backport work from review packages 2020-04-20 23:11:53 +02:00
Jeroen Engels
2d42e89092 Backport work from review packages 2020-04-08 18:36:56 +02:00
Jeroen Engels
1f38de974a Backport work from NoUnused 2020-04-04 15:56:40 +02:00
Jeroen Engels
7716c9d2c9 Remove Rule.withFixes function 2020-04-04 12:58:26 +02:00
Jeroen Engels
60106d7958 Add NoUnused rules like they are in jfmengels/review-unused 2020-04-03 16:19:24 +02:00